Pricing
Solar21 is a technology company that specializes in providing subscription solar energy services.
Industries
Headquarters
Employees
Links
Org chart
Teams
Offices
Full screen
View all (0)
This company has no teams yet
View all
HQ
3 people · 0 jobs
Audax Renovables
3 followers
KORE Power
GE Vernova
65 followers
EDF Energy
30 followers
Eneva
5 followers
Terra Firma Solutions
7 followers
Vitol
37 followers
Natural Power
4 followers
Shell
425 followers
ExxonMobil
282 followers
Reliance Industries
Explore companies